About the hotel

A fitness center, a snack bar/deli, and self parking are available at this smoke-free hotel. Free continental breakfast and free WiFi in public areas are also provided. Additionally, coffee/tea in a common area, a business center, and a meeting room are onsite.

Nearby attractions

Hampton Inn & Suites Atlanta Downtown is located in Downtown Atlanta, a neighborhood in Atlanta, and is near a metro station. World of Coca Cola is a cultural highlight and some of the area's popular attractions include Zoo Atlanta and Six Flags Over Georgia. Looking to enjoy an event or a game? See what's going on at Mercedes-Benz Stadium or Truist Park. Spend some time exploring the area's activities, including golfing. Guests appreciate the hotel's central location.
